National Bowhunter Education Foundation Sponsors Nebraska Hunter Education Conference

Posted on: Aug 21, 2026

RAPID CITY, SD (August 24, 2026) – National Bowhunter Education Foundation (NBEF) sponsored the recent Nebraska Hunter Education Conference in Omaha, NE.

NBEF Executive Director Marilyn Bentz; Tree Stand Safety Association President Glenn Mayhew; and area Hunter Ed Instructor and former Nebraska Hunter Ed Coordinator Jackson Ellis, provided workshops on tree stand safety and hunting saddle safety. The workshop content was based on the recently updated TSSA ABC’s of Tree Stand Safety and ABC’s of Hunting Saddle Safety. In addition to providing lunch for the group of statewide volunteer instructors, the NBEF also provided five-foot vertical banner stands of the ABC’s for use in hunter ed/bowhunter ed classes and various consumer events.

It was fitting that NBEF and Nebraska Hunter Ed Coordinator Kyle Gaston debuted a new combo Today’s Hunter and Today’s Bowhunter Manual at the event because Nebraska hunter educators were the impetus for its creation. 

“It’s always a pleasure to be involved with this event. The State of Nebraska has a strong hunter education and bowhunter education program with dedicated instructors,” explained Marilyn Bentz, NBEF Executive Director. “Not only is the Nebraska’s bowhunting mentoring program nationally renowned but they are known for leading the way in education innovations such as the combo course both in print and online.”

“We appreciate our continued and long-standing partnership with NBEF,” said Nebraska Hunter Education Coordinator Kyle Gaston. “NBEF is instrumental in our bowhunter education and elevated hunting safety curriculum as well as Nebraska’s evolving hunter recruitment, retention and reactivation initiatives.”  

Volunteers were honored for their years of continuous service as bowhunter education instructors in Nebraska. They were presented certificates and pins for their years of service. Most notable were those individuals honored for serving 25 years or more of service to the State of Nebraska. Several in attendance had more than 35 years of service.

About NBEF

The National Bowhunter Education Foundation offers instructional content and tools for bowhunter education and hunter education. Helping bowhunters become safe and successful hunters and stewards of the sport are important NBEF missions. NBEF provides the bowhunter certification curriculum and class content that some states and certain circumstances require to bow hunt. NBEF provides instructor training and certification.

NBEF oversees the International Bowhunter Education Program and works with the International Hunter Education Association and state agencies to coordinate a unified program. States may have additional requirements. Europe and other countries offer full reciprocity for the NBEF (IBEP) certification and conduct classes.

NBEF also oversees the International Crossbow Education Program and works with state agencies responsible for crossbow education to develop comprehensive online crossbow safety courses that teach students important laws and regulations, game identification, and safe, responsible handling of crossbow equipment.

NBEF is a 501(c)3 corporation that isn’t a membership-based organization. Tax-deductible donations to support this non-profit are welcome.
